Did you know Tharpa also produces these special books?

The Kangyur and Tengyur are the collections of all Buddha’s teachings of Sutra and Ta**ra translated from Sanskrit into Tibetan, as well as their commentaries 📕

You can find them in Kadampa Temples throughout the world, often with statues of Amitayus - the Buddha of long life, good fortune and wisdom ❤️

“Inner peace, or mental peace, is the source of all our happiness. Although all living beings have the same basic wish to be happy all the time, very few people understand the real causes of happiness. We usually believe that external conditions such as food, friends, cars and money are the real causes of happiness, and as a result we devote nearly all our time and energy to acquiring them. Superficially it seems that these things can make us happy, but if we look more deeply we will see that they also bring us a lot of suffering and problems.”

from How to Transform Your Life
by Geshe Kelsang Gyatso

“Our body is a visual form that possesses colour and shape, but our mind is a formless continuum that always lacks colour and shape. As explained in Part One, the nature of our mind is empty like space, and its function is to perceive or understand objects. Through this we can understand that our brain is not our mind. The brain is simply a part of our body that, for example, can be photographed, whereas our mind cannot.”

from How to Understand the Mind
by Geshe Kelsang Gyatso

“All Buddha’s teachings are either Sutra, the common teachings, or Ta**ra, the uncommon teachings; there is not a single scripture of Buddha that is not one of these two. Sutra teachings are divided into two types: Hinayana Sutras and Mahayana Sutras. Of these, the Essence of Wisdom Sutra belongs to the category of Mahayana Sutras. The Mahayana Sutras themselves comprise many different types of teaching, but the most precious and supreme are the Perfection of Wisdom Sutras (Skt. Prajnaparamitasutra). Buddha’s ultimate intention is to lead each and every living being to the supreme happiness of enlightenment by showing them the Mahayana path. For this purpose he taught the Perfection of Wisdom Sutras.”

from The New Heart of Wisdom
by Geshe Kelsang Gyatso

“Buddhas have ten special qualities not possessed by sentient beings, which are called the ‘ten forces’, and one of these is the force knowing all paths. Buddhas know all internal paths and where they lead to. Out of their great compassion, they teach living beings how to discriminate between correct paths and incorrect paths. If Buddhas did not teach Dharma, we would never know about the paths to liberation and, because of our familiarity with self-grasping, we would wander in samsara forever with no hope of escape. We have been following incorrect paths since beginningless time but now, through the kindness of Buddha Shakyamuni, we have the opportunity to study a complete presentation of the spiritual paths to liberation and full enlightenment.”

from Ta***ic Grounds and Paths
by Geshe Kelsang Gyatso
